Identify your hair type and its needs

You probably already know what type of hair you have, but it doesn't hurt to take another assessment, because a first step in spring hair care is to understand your hair type and how it recovers after the cold season. Hair that's dry, brittle or prone to weight gain has different needs. For example:

  • Dry and damaged hair: It needs intense moisturizing to counteract the drying effects of cold weather.
  • Oily hairFor oily hair, spring can bring increased sebum production due to temperature changes. That's why it's also important to watch your diet and care products that balance your scalp's natural sebum production.
  • Normal hair: It may need a balance between moisturization and protection against external factors.

Keeps hair moisturized

In spring, our hair needs more intense moisturizing, which you can achieve with nourishing hair masks that restore its elasticity and shine. Choose products with natural ingredients such as honey, avocado or aloe vera. Apply a hair mask once a week and leave it on for 15-20 minutes for best results. In addition, avoid excessive use of heat-emitting styling appliances (hair straighteners, curling irons) as they can contribute to hair damage.

Scalp exfoliation: the overlooked but very important step

A clean and healthy scalp is essential for beautiful hair. Spring is a good time to exfoliate your scalp to remove dead cells and stimulate blood circulation. This will allow your hair to grow healthier and stronger. Exfoliating your scalp can be done with special scalp products or even by using natural solutions such as brown sugar or coffee. Massaging the scalp while shampooing helps stimulate hair follicles and cleanse them of impurities. In addition, this massage improves blood circulation and therefore the health of the hair.

Protects hair from UV rays

It's not only your skin that needs UV protection, but also your hair. UV exposure weakens hair and makes it prone to breakage. Using a UV protection spray is a great way to protect your hair from the sun's damaging rays, as these products form a protective layer that prevents damage caused by prolonged exposure to the sun. If you spend a lot of time in the sun, it's also a good idea to protect your hair with hats, scarves or other shading accessories.

Adjust your diet

Healthy skin and hair are often the result of a balanced diet. In spring, it's essential to eat foods rich in vitamins and minerals, which help strengthen hair. Vitamins A, C, E and vitamin B complex are important for maintaining healthy hair. Fruits, vegetables, nuts and seeds are excellent sources of nutrients that support hair health, not to mention water, which is essential for maintaining overall hydration.

Avoid potentially contaminating products

Some chemicals in hair care products can lead to long-term damage. Opt for shampoos and conditioners that are free from parabens, sulphates and alcohol, which can dry out hair. Instead, choose products that contain natural ingredients such as essential oils, plant extracts and proteins from silk or keratin.

Go to the hairdresser regularly

Spring is also an ideal time to go to the hairdresser. A regular trim helps to remove split ends and maintain healthy hair. Plus, a fresh cut can revitalize hair and add volume and texture. Whether you opt for a light cut to freshen up the look or a more drastic change, a spring haircut may be just what you need to revive your hair.
